Living as a recluse in his apartment in Neuilly-sur-Seine during the Occupation, Kandinsky dreamed of a cosmic and poetic world. ln 1940, Wassily Kandinsky went to see Joan Miro in Varengeville-sur-Mer. Further to this visit, he borrowed the surrealist artist's "colour of [his] dreams" and constellations of biomorphic shapes.

Inspired by an old tapestry discovered in Paris, the little creatures here give the painting an optimistic air, even though the German occupation had caused Kandinsky and his wife Nina to live withdrawn at their home in Neuilly.
